An update on the End of Life Options Act in Colorado (Proposition 106): December 16, 2016.
Colorado has become the sixth state to allow terminally ill adults with six months or fewer to live and suffering unbearable the option to request, obtain and if they so choose, self-administer a prescription medicine to bring about a peaceful death. Compassion and Choices, the nationally based organization that works to implement this option in select states, is launching the Colorado Access Campaign to ensure that dying people who are suffering have access to the law.
